I take no position on whether Debian is correct in its assessment of
such things, but I reiterate my previous opposition to breaking it
just because we don't agree with it, or because Tom specifically
doesn't. It's too mainstream a platform to arbitrarily break. And it
will probably just have the effect of increasing the number of patches
they're carrying against our sources, which will not make things
better for anybody.
